Sorry you have a problem with your first ratsnake, but you didn't pick the easiest one. You didn't say how big it is. Most rats are easy to care for and handle. I had taiwans in the past and could handle them, no problem, even when they were over 4 ft...but at feeding time it was a different story. This subspecies of taeniura is a very aggressive feeder..if you want to keep your fingers you know how to act. Stripe-tailed rats usually tame down with handling but its true they seem to be part racer. Good luck nightflight..this is a tremendous species and i hope you stick with it...Terry.
